No.22 Blazers Fall Short in Series Opener Against West Florida, 6-5

VALDOSTA, Ga.- The No. 22 Valdosta State softball team fell in the Gulf South Conference series opener with West Florida on Friday evening, 6-5.

With the loss the Blazers fell to 32-13 overall and 18-10 in GSC play while UWF improved to 21-20 overall and 12-15 in conference play.

The game kicked off with the Argonauts striking first in the top of the second. UWF tacked on a triple and a single back-to-back to go up 1-0 by the end of the frame.

The Argos held their 1-0 lead until the fourth inning. In the bottom of that inning, sophomore Abby Sulte took a lead-off walk and freshman Lexi Patterson smacked a hard-hit single to center field to put two Blazers on base. Junior Katie Proctor then hit a towering three-run homer to give the Blazers the lead, 3-1.

West Florida answered right back in the top of the fifth with a double and a pair of sacrifice bunts to advance an Argonaut home and cut the VSU lead to 3-2. The Argonauts then tacked on four more runs in the top of sixth on a string of base hits and a Blazer miscue to take back the lead, 6-3.

Valdosta State fought back in the bottom of the sixth as freshman Saylor McNearney took a walk to kick off the inning. McNearney stole second before advancing to third on a wild pitch. Junior Taylor Macera then reached base on an Argo throwing error as McNearney scored to cut the UWF lead to two, 6-4.

In the top of the seventh, senior Taylor Lewis blasted her 14th home run of the season on a solo shot to bring VSU within one, 6-5. However, the Blazers came up just short, falling to the Argos in game one, 6-5.

In the circle for the Blazers, senior Samantha Richards recorded her 28th complete game of the season and eighth loss of the year (23-8). In seven total innings, Richards fanned three, walked one and allowed six runs on 10 hits. At the dish for the Blazers, Proctor tallied one hit for one run and three RBI on her booming three-run homer to earn Guardian Bank Player of the Game honors.
